The nakshatras are the 27 lunar mansions of Vedic astrology — the zodiac divided into 27 segments of 13°20′ each, through which the Moon travels in its monthly cycle. Your Janma Nakshatra (the nakshatra the Moon occupied at your birth) shapes personality, destiny, naming, the Vimshottari dasha sequence and marriage compatibility. Each nakshatra is further split into four padas (quarters). Pick one below for its full guide.
How nakshatras are classified
Each nakshatra also carries a ruling planet (its Vimshottari dasha lord), a presiding deity, an animal (yoni) and a nadi — all used in Vedic personality reading and kundli matching.
